Sha256: c72ff7c41e0745f5dd4193880e0f31aea3a35187221aa902ccfa644709c7816e

Contents?: true

Size: 438 Bytes

Versions: 1

Compression:

Stored size: 438 Bytes

Contents

require "rubygems"
require "bundler/setup"
require "active_support/all"
require "pathname"
require "ruby-progressbar"
require "taglib"
require "zeitwerk"

loader = Zeitwerk::Loader.for_gem
loader.setup
loader.eager_load

module PlexSymlinker
  class Error < StandardError; end

  def self.output
    @output ||= STDOUT
  end

  def self.output=(val)
    @output = val
  end

  def self.logger
    @logger ||= Logger.new(output)
  end
end

Version data entries

1 entries across 1 versions & 1 rubygems

Version Path
plex_symlinker-0.1.0 lib/plex_symlinker.rb